The bharatiya janata party (BJP) is gearing up for the upcoming parliamentary elections, with hopes of securing a third consecutive term in power at the Centre. The party is setting an ambitious target of winning 300 seats on its own, with a broader goal of achieving 400 seats together with the national democratic alliance (NDA) alliance.

In the process of candidate selection, the party leadership is reportedly considering fielding bollywood star akshay kumar and leading actress kangana Ranaut. The names of these two celebrities are expected to be included in the first list of bjp candidates for the parliamentary elections, which may be released in the coming days.


Kangana Ranaut, known for her roles in lady-oriented films, has previously expressed interest in joining politics and has been associated with the BJP. Her home state is Himachal Pradesh, and there are speculations that she might contest from Mandi. akshay kumar, a popular actor known for his support of the bjp government, is rumored to be considered for the chandni Chowk constituency in Delhi.


The bjp has a history of fielding actors in elections, with personalities like ravi Kishan, Sunny Deol, and hema malini having contested and won seats in previous elections. The addition of kangana ranaut and akshay kumar is expected to bring glamour to the party's election campaign.


The first list of bjp candidates, which is anticipated to include more than 110 names, may also feature prime minister Narendra Modi contesting from Varanasi, a seat he successfully contested in the 2014 and 2019 elections. home minister amit shah is expected to contest from Gandhinagar, Gujarat. The party plans to allocate seats to sitting MPs in various constituencies as part of its strategy.
